In order to progress to Year 10 of the scale, an Environmental Health Officer must have:

 

(i)         completed 12 months service at the salary  prescribed on the maximum of the scale; and

 

(ii)        have demonstrated to the satisfaction of the Corporation by the work performed and the results achieved, the aptitude and qualities of  mind warranting such payment.

 

After 12 months satisfactory work performance on Year 10, the officer will progress to the year 11 rate.  Under no circumstances can Environmental Health Officers receive Year 10 or Year 11 rates unless they fulfil these criteria.

For the purposes of calculation of payments to officers pursuant to the provisions of this award, one hour's pay shall be calculated in accordance with the following formula:

 

Annual Salary

x

1

52.17857

 

38

 

and one day's pay shall be calculated by multiplying one hour's pay (as calculated in accordance with the above formula) by 7.6

The above allowance is paid to officers who obtain an appropriate higher medical qualification subsequent to  graduation.  It does not apply to an officer appointed as a Senior Registrar.

 

The salary prescribed for a Senior Registrar has taken into account that a higher medical qualification is a prerequisite for appointment.

Provided that no officer may be employed for more than 24 hours in any period of 7 consecutive days.

 

Formula: Part-time Medical Officer with less that 3 years post-graduate experience = 1st year Registrar divided by 52.17857 divided by 38 plus 15%.

 

Part-time Medical Officer with more than 3 years post-graduate experience = 3rd year Registrar divided by 52.17857 divided by 38 plus 15%.

 

Part-time Medical Officer with more that 6 years post-graduate experience = Senior Registrar divided by 52.17857 divided by 38 plus 15%.
